# Crashpile settings — support team notes
# This block controls the Fernwhistle mobile crash-report pipeline.
# Symbolication runs first, then reports land in the triage queue you all
# see in the Lanternbird dashboard. If reports stop flowing, check the
# ingest worker before blaming the app — nine times out of ten it's the
# worker losing its DB session after a deploy. Retention is 90 days,
# don't change it without asking. The pipeline writes everything to the
# store referenced by the connection string below.

replica DSN, kajep-yahag: mssql://praok_svc:iF@db-8d68.plorvaio.local:5432/eliion

MEETING NOTES — Backup Rotation Review, Ostrander Logistics

Attendees agreed the weekly off-site rotation of backup tapes from the Fenwick Road server room is overdue for tightening. Tapes must be logged out in the transit register, sealed in the grey cases, and stored upright during transport. The shift lead is responsible for verifying seal numbers before release and after return. Quarterly tapes go to the Marlowe Vault facility. The courier hand-over instruction, which is confidential, appears directly below.

courier memo of tawep-tajep: the quenius ulaiel courier leaves the fenir ledger at gate 9128 under passcode 527513

# Leadership Review Briefing: Calloway Licensing Dispute

Quick recap for department heads: Calloway Instruments claims our Brightline module infringes their usage terms, and talks stalled last week. Legal says our position is solid but a drawn-out fight would delay the Brightline 3 launch. Options on the table are settle, counter-license, or litigate. We'll pick a lane at Thursday's review. The confidential planning note is appended below.

management briefing: Jorixax Holdings is in early talks to buy Casixax Holdings for about $420.3 million. The Fenmir launch date is October 27, and nothing goes to the press before then. Legal wants the Keloxek Foods term sheet redrafted before April 16.

Headcount Plan — Next Year (Restricted)

Sales leads: the draft plan adds six field roles across the Velmont and Aster regions, contingent on the Corix renewal closing. Backfills for departures are approved only where territory coverage drops below plan. Please review your region's figures carefully before the December sign-off. The underlying assumption is stated below.

internal memo for kahop-yajof: The steering committee signed off on a budget of $12.6 million for Project Jorwyn. The renewal with Quenoxox Logistics closes at $16.8 million a year, 48 percent above the last contract.